AS.AGR Associate in Science: Agricultural Sciences Requirements
A minimum of 60 credits is required to complete this program.
- ENG.111 Freshman English Composition 3 Credits
- ENG.222 Expository Writing & Research 3 Credits
- COM.101 Fundamentals of Communication 3 Credits
- or COM.257 Public Speaking 3 Credits
- Two courses from different subject areas selected from the MTA Natural Science list.
- MAT.107 College Algebra 3 Credits
- or MAT.114 Mathematical Reasoning 3 Credits
- or MAT.212 Introduction to Probability & Statistics 3 Credits
- Two courses from different subject areas selected from the MTA Social Science list
- MTA Social Science Course
- MTA Social Science Course
- Two courses from different subject areas selected from the MTA Humanities list
- MTA Humanities Course
- MTA Humanities Course
Select one Concentration.
Agriculture Business
16 Credit Hours from the following options.
- ACC.201 Financial Accounting 4 Credits
- AGR.102 Introduction to Animal Science 4 Credits
- AGR.103 Introduction to Crop & Plant Science 4 Credits
- AGR. 105 Professional Agriculture Seminar 2 Credits
- AGR.130 Farm Management 3 Credits
- AGR.201 Introduction to Agriculture Economics 3 Credits
- AGR.204 Agriculture Perceptions in Agriculture & Community Issues 2 Credits
Crop & Soil Science
14 Credit Hours from the following options.
- AGR.103 Introduction to Crop & Plant Science 4 Credits
- AGR.104 Introduction to Soil Science 3 Credits
- AGR.204 Agriculture Perceptions in Agriculture & Community Issues 2 Credits
- BIO.201 Botany 4 Credits
- CHM.112 General College Chemistry III 5 Credits
Animal Science
14 Credit Hours from the following options.
- AGR.102 Introduction to Animal Science 4 Credits
- AGR.201 Introduction to Agriculture Economics 3 Credits
- AGR.203 Animal Health & Nutrition 2 Credits
- AGR.204 Agriculture Perceptions in Agriculture & Community Issues 2 Credits
- CHM.112 General College Chemistry III 5 Credits
- CHM.245 Organic Chemistry I - Lecture 4 Credits
- CHM.255 Organic Chemistry II - Lab 1 Credit
